Warehouse Remnant Transfer Report
Report Module Guide: Warehouse Remnant Transfer Report
Module Location
Inventory > Reports > Warehouse Remnant Transfer Report
Module Objective
The Warehouse Remnant Transfer Report module is used to generate a report that tracks the remaining quantity from uncompleted warehouse transfer transactions. This report is useful for monitoring goods that have been shipped but have not yet been fully received at the destination warehouse.

3. Reading the Report (Report Content)
The generated report is a list of transfer transactions that likely still have a remaining balance or have not been fully received.
This report displays important details such as:
-
Warehouse Receipt Number: The receipt document number at the destination warehouse.
-
Warehouse Shipment Number: The shipment document number from the source warehouse.
-
Quantity to be Transferred: The quantity that was supposed to be transferred.
-
Quantity Received: The quantity that has already been received.
-
Remaining Quantity: The difference between the quantity transferred and the quantity received.
Tips & Important Notes
-
This report is very useful for following up on inter-warehouse shipments that are incomplete or have quantity discrepancies.
-
Focus on rows that have a number in the Remaining Quantity column to identify problems in the transfer process.
-
This is an important control report for the Logistics team and Warehouse Managers.
